We have completed our review of your responses to Item 4.2, " Reactor Trip System Reliability" of Generic Letter 83-28, " Required Actions Based on Generic Implications of Salem ATWS Events." We conclude that the infonnation submitted in response to Item 4.2 is acceptable. Our Safety Evaluation is enclosed.
